Eating Malasada's

When my honey
comes around
from out of town,
we share a box
of malasada's.
Haven't ate
too many
malasada's
as of late.

JamesLee
31August
2007

Malasada-Egg sized ball
of yeast dough that are
deep fried in oil and
coated with granulated
sugar...Wikipedia
refer:Hawaii.edu/recipes/
recipes.html
